EPA Violations
- 22 total violations across Ocean City
- 4 health-based violations
- 2 of 2 ZIP codes have violations
- 0 ZIP codes exceed EPA lead action level
Top Contaminants
| Contaminant | Violations | ZIPs |
|---|---|---|
| Stage 2 DBP Rule | 10 | 2 |
| Total Trihalomethanes (TTHM) | 4 | 2 |
| Consumer Confidence Report Rule | 4 | 2 |
| Nickel | 2 | 2 |
| Surface Water Treatment Rule | 2 | 2 |
